As parents, keeping our children healthy is a top priority. A strong immune system helps kids fight off common illnesses and recover more quickly. While no single solution can prevent sickness entirely, incorporating natural immune-boosting strategies can make a significant difference in their overall health.
Top Natural Immune-Boosting Strategies
1. Prioritize a Nutrient-Dense Diet
- Include whole foods rich in vitamins and minerals, such as f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, and healthy fats.
- Vitamin C-rich foods (oranges, bell peppers, strawberries) and zinc sources (nuts, seeds, legumes) support immune function.
- Minimize processed foods and added sugars that can weaken the immune system.
2. Support Gut Health
- A healthy gut is essential for a strong immune system.
- Include probiotic-rich foods like yogurt, kefir, sauerkraut, and kimchi.
- Fiber-rich foods like bananas, apples, and oats help nourish beneficial gut bacteria.
3. Encourage Quality Sleep
- Ensure kids get age-appropriate amounts of sleep each night (10-12 hours for younger children).
- Establish a calming bedtime routine to promote restful sleep.
- Avoid screens and blue light exposure before bedtime.
4. Keep Kids Active
- Regular physical activity helps boost immune function and overall well-being.
- Encourage outdoor play, sports, and family walks.
- Movement reduces stress, which can weaken immunity.
